ZIP Code 42753 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Adair County, Kentucky, home to about 812 residents. At $51,806, its median household income sits in line with Adair County's $50,316.

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 42753's population grew 2.8% from 790 to 812.

87.8% of homes are single-family detached houses. The typical home was built around 1985.
